What is the potential salary for a computer programmer?
Pay. The median annual wage for computer programmers was $97,800 in May 2022.How much does it pay to be a computer programmer?
The annual median salary for computer programmers in the US is $91,116 [2]. This figure includes a base salary of $85,177 and a reported additional pay of $5,939 per year. Additional pay may include bonuses, commissions, or profit-sharing. However, salaries for computer programmers depend on several factors.Is computer programming high paying?

How much do Python programmers make?
Glassdoor. According to Python Developer Salary data from Glassdoor mid-level Python Developers earn an average of $132,000 annually in 2024 up from $101,920 in 2023. In contrast, Senior Python Developers take home a salary of at least $159,000 per year down from $163,000 in 2023.Is it easy to make money as a programmer?

How much does a Programmer make in United Kingdom? The average programmer salary in the United Kingdom is £32,500 per year or £16.67 per hour. Entry level positions start at £28,275 per year while most experienced workers make up to £50,000 per year.Can you make 7 figures in coding?
